I just purchased my '11 335d (nearly all options besides Logic 7 and forward park distance control) 6 weeks ago. Absolutely love it! MSRP was around $56k. However, because it's a diesel, BMW gives $4500 off right away. In addition, you also get a $900
credit on your taxes. Not write-off, $ for $ credit. So all said and done, my car came out around $51k before even talking numbers with the dealer, which gave me $2500 off (they wanted to maintain 2% over invoice). In case you're not keeping a tally, mine cost $48,500 before taxes/licensing. Add in the savings in gas, and the car is an absolute steal.
